华为鸿蒙系统的校验机制概述177
华为鸿蒙系统是一个分布式的操作系统,它由多个独立的、可组合的子系统组成,这些子系统可以在不同的设备上运行。为了确保鸿蒙系统的安全性和可靠性,华为引入了完善的校验机制,用于确保系统和数据的完整性。
鸿蒙系统的校验机制
鸿蒙系统的校验机制包括:
1. 启动校验:
在系统启动时,鸿蒙系统会对引导加载程序、内核、文件系统和其他关键组件进行签名校验。如果校验失败,系统将拒绝启动并提示用户。这可以防止恶意软件或未经授权的修改破坏系统。
2. 内存保护:
鸿蒙系统使用内存保护机制来防止恶意代码执行未经授权的操作。它将内存划分为不同的区域,每个区域具有特定的权限和访问控制。这有助于防止缓冲区溢出和其他类型的内存攻击。
3. 文件系统校验:
鸿蒙的文件系统支持校验和机制,用于确保文件数据的完整性。当文件被写入或读取时,校验和会自动计算并存储。如果校验和不匹配,系统将提示用户文件已损坏。
4. 代码签名:
鸿蒙系统要求所有应用程序和驱动程序都经过签名。签名由受信任的证书颁发机构颁发,它确保代码是合法的并且没有被篡改。这可以防止安装和运行恶意软件。
5. 系统更新校验:
当鸿蒙系统进行更新时,它会对更新包进行签名校验。如果校验失败,系统将拒绝安装更新,防止恶意更新破坏系统。
鸿蒙系统的校验好处
鸿蒙系统的严格校验机制提供了以下好处:* 提高安全性:防止恶意软件和未经授权的修改破坏系统。
* 增强可靠性:确保关键组件和数据的完整性和一致性。
* 简化维护:自动校验和修复机制简化了系统的维护和管理。
* 提高用户信任:让用户确信他们的设备和数据是安全的。
鸿蒙系统的校验与其他操作系统
与其他操作系统相比,鸿蒙系统的校验机制具有以下优势:* 分布式架构:鸿蒙的分布式架构使得校验机制可以跨越多个设备和组件进行,提供更全面的保护。
* 动态可组装:鸿蒙的动态可组装特性允许在运行时添加或删除组件,而不会影响校验机制。
* 统一的安全框架:鸿蒙提供了一个统一的安全框架,将不同的校验机制集成在一起,实现无缝的安全管理。
华为鸿蒙系统的完善校验机制是其安全性、可靠性和用户信任的基础。通过在系统启动、内存保护、文件系统、代码签名和系统更新各方面实施严格的校验,鸿蒙系统可以有效地防止恶意软件、未经授权的修改和数据损坏,从而保护用户的数据和隐私。
2024-11-04
上一篇:Linux 中自定义系统字体
下一篇:Linux 系统远程管理指南